Judge imposes 'inadequate' ten-year sentence on four men
Four men have been given the maximum sentence of 10 years for disposing of and attempting to destroy the body of a mother-of-two beaten to death in Wexford last year.
Three of them had part of their sentences suspended provided they return to their native Lithuania and Poland when released from jail. The fourth man, who is Irish, also had part of his sentence suspended at the Central Criminal Court.
